The Rise of Doja Cat: A Cultural Phenomenon
Doja Cat first grabbed attention in 2018. Her viral hit “Mooo!” certainly made big waves. The song humorously parodied internet culture. It showcased her unique mix of humor and catchy tunes. This track alone amassed over [70 million YouTube views](https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=mXn_3YkY6d0). It shot her straight into the spotlight. I believe her fresh musical approach truly connects. It deeply resonates with our current digital age. Virality often decides who truly thrives there.
But here’s the thing: Doja Cat was not just a one-hit wonder. Her next albums really pushed many boundaries. “Hot Pink” and “Planet Her” are perfect examples. “Planet Her” debuted high on charts. It landed at number two on the [Billboard 200 chart](https://www.billboard.com/charts/billboard-200). Since then, it has gathered over [1.1 billion Spotify streams](https://open.spotify.com/album/1XJzK4P3rRKE03Z3y2f1e6). These numbers really show her power. She captivates a massive audience. They crave something new. Her music mixes pop, R&B, and hip-hop. It even has some rock elements. This blend shows modern listeners’ varied tastes. They actively seek diverse sounds.

The Influence of Social Media on Music Trends
It’s no secret that social media platforms changed music forever. Doja Cat has mastered platforms like TikTok. She uses Instagram incredibly well too. Her song “Say So” became a TikTok sensation. It led to the song’s huge comeback. It hit number one on the [Billboard Hot 100 in 2020](https://www.billboard.com/music/doja-cat/chart-history/hot-100). Imagine the raw power of a simple dance challenge! It can push a song to the very top. TikTok has completely transformed how we consume music. It changed how music gets marketed. Doja Cat truly embodies this trend.
The statistics certainly support this idea. A report by the [Digital Media Association](https://www.billboard.com/pro/riaa-digital-music-report-2023-revenue-streaming/) confirms it. Seventy-five percent of Gen Z users find new music on social media. This discovery method is their primary one. Doja Cat connects with her fans wonderfully. She shares humorous videos. She offers candid, real moments too. This creates a powerful sense of community. This strategy builds her fanbase significantly. It also sets a new standard for artists. Cultural Commentary and Representation
Doja Cat’s lyrics often cover important themes. Empowerment, sexuality, and identity are common threads. Her song “Woman” celebrates femininity. It highlights strength beautifully. The music video is powerful too. It represents many diverse female experiences. The song’s impact is clear. It gained over [100 million streams](https://www.forbes.com/sites/caitlinkelley/2021/08/17/doja-cat-woman-hit-100-million-streams-on-spotify/) within its first month. That’s truly amazing.
The cultural impact of her work is immense. Doja Cat has become a voice for many. She challenges old stereotypes directly. She promotes body positivity effectively. A survey by the [Pew Research Center](https://www.pewresearch.org/social-trends/2021/05/27/womens-views-on-gender-equality-and-the-impact-of-pop-culture/) found something important. Fifty-four percent of women aged 18-29 agreed. They feel pop culture representation greatly affects their self-esteem. This statistic really shows the value of artists like Doja Cat. Influences Revealed: What Doja Cat Reads, Watches, and Listens To
To understand Doja Cat’s artistic choices, look at her influences. It’s truly essential. In interviews, she has often spoken about her admiration. She likes artists from [Nicki Minaj to Erykah Badu](https://www.gq.com/story/doja-cat-interview). This wide-ranging taste shows in her music. It often combines playful lyrics with profound themes. This mix is quite unique.
Moreover, Doja Cat has talked about her love for anime. She says it inspires her visual style. It also shapes her music videos. For example, her video for “Get Into It (Yuh)” is a prime example. It features elements from Japanese pop culture. It has vibrant colors. It tells imaginative stories. This blend of influences really highlights something. Opposing Views and Critical Perspectives
While Doja Cat’s impact is large, not everyone agrees on its nature. Some critics question the long-term impact of viral fame. Is it just fleeting? They wonder if it truly builds lasting artistry. Others argue her persona can sometimes seem inauthentic. They say it feels too performative. This perspective suggests her focus on controversy or shock value. It might distract from her musical talent.
Frankly, some older music fans often resist genre blending. They prefer clear, defined categories for music. They might see it as diluting musical traditions. It’s a very valid viewpoint. I remember when rock and roll first mixed genres. Many people truly disliked it. This shows that every new trend faces resistance.
Others worry about social media’s influence too. They believe it forces artists into content creation. It perhaps pulls them away from pure musical craft. They argue this might reduce artistic depth.
